Founding

Technical University of Munich's founder is recorded as Ludwig II of Bavaria[16]. 1868 marks the founding of it[28].

Leadership

Technical University of Munich's chairperson is recorded as Thomas F. Hofmann[24].

Operations

Technical University of Munich's headquarters location is recorded as Munich[17]. Subsidiaries include Centre for Advanced Laser Applications[19], a research institute[29], in Germany[30], founded in 2006[31]; TUM School of Engineering and Design[20], a faculty[32], in Germany[33], founded in 1868[34]; Q113110822[21], a faculty[35], in Germany[36], founded in 1868[37]; and TUM School of Computation, Information and Technology[22], a faculty[38], in Germany[39], founded in 2022[40].
